Transaction 89c108e39a2590e7fc21e586cb2f28429f2d488caed0f94d782b903d4935c2cf

1 Input
2 Outputs
  • 89c108e39a2590e7fc21e586cb2f28429f2d488caed0f94d782b903d4935c2cf:0
  • value  592865
    address  1Ar2PPNRhmDFMGkx1or5xn2KxW8G6cZ2z6
  • 89c108e39a2590e7fc21e586cb2f28429f2d488caed0f94d782b903d4935c2cf:1
  • value  20998880
    address  1vFFSrk3WeFggX1krnBBeUoPreh4EAqha